At a Glance
- Tasks: Join a global team to develop web applications and solutions using Java and Angular.
- Company: Stefanini North America, a leader in IT services with a collaborative culture.
- Benefits: Full-time role with opportunities for personal and technical growth.
- Why this job: Make an impact in information security while working with cutting-edge technologies.
- Qualifications: Experience in full stack development and a passion for learning new tech.
- Other info: Dynamic, agile environment with mentorship from experienced colleagues.
The predicted salary is between 28800 - 48000 £ per year.
Join to apply for the Java Developer role at Stefanini North America and APAC.
You will be joining the innovative Information Security Cybertech Engineering team as a full stack software engineer in a global team responsible for developing web applications (Java/Angular), data engineering (Python) and solutions with third party products. You will be working in a collaborative and inclusive fast-paced environment that leverages agile approaches to deliver solutions quickly. You will work directly with the project leads, stakeholders, and engineers to understand the problem, determine, and design the solution that is both robust and quick to market.
The suite of applications developed and maintained by the team are used to enhance the firm's information security threat detection, compliance, entitlement management architectures and audit assurance programs. You'll have the freedom to challenge the status quo, mentor fellow engineers, and contribute to our ongoing success while continuously fostering your own personal and professional growth.
Key Responsibilities- Full stack software development and management of the development life cycle.
- Innovative, understanding, and problemāsolving mindset of complex scenarios.
- Experience with full stack software development (front and backend with DB/APIs).
- Direct stakeholder engagement and full software development life cycle management.
- Opportunity to research, develop and implement prototypes/solutions using new technologies.
- Personal and technical growth is fostered under the mentorship of a group of vastly experienced, technically focused colleagues.
- Operating in an agile and multiātasking environment.
- Selfāmotivated and well organised.
- Passionate about technologies and continually learn new technologies.
- Strong ability to prioritise, manage and perform multiple tasks.
- Curious, attentive to detail and seeks clarity.
- Able to work individually and within a team.
- Excellent written and verbal communication skills.
- Proficient working with source code repositories (Azure and/or GIT).
- Excellent understanding of object orientated programming and scripting.
- Experience writing complex SQL queries (Sybase advantageous).
- Proficient with UNIX/LINUX operating systems/commands.
- Understanding of API Services (SOAP, REST, Graph).
- Proficient in Java EE with OpenJDK
- Proficient with Spring 4.0+ Framework
- Proficient with Spring Boot/Wildfly web servers (or similar)
- Proficient with Angular 14+
Employment type Fullātime
Job function Engineering and Information Technology
Industries IT Services and IT Consulting
Java Developer in Edinburgh employer: Stefanini North America and APAC
Contact Detail:
Stefanini North America and APAC Recruiting Team
StudySmarter Expert Advice š¤«
We think this is how you could land Java Developer in Edinburgh
āØTip Number 1
Network like a pro! Reach out to your connections in the tech industry, especially those who work at Stefanini or similar companies. A friendly chat can open doors and give you insider info on job openings.
āØTip Number 2
Prepare for the interview by brushing up on your Java and Angular skills. We recommend doing some mock interviews with friends or using online platforms to get comfortable with common questions and coding challenges.
āØTip Number 3
Show off your projects! If you've built any web applications or worked on relevant tech projects, make sure to highlight them during your interview. Itās a great way to demonstrate your skills and passion for development.
āØTip Number 4
Donāt forget to apply through our website! Itās the best way to ensure your application gets noticed. Plus, we often have exclusive roles listed there that you wonāt find anywhere else.
We think you need these skills to ace Java Developer in Edinburgh
Some tips for your application š«”
Tailor Your CV: Make sure your CV is tailored to the Java Developer role. Highlight your experience with Java, Angular, and any relevant projects you've worked on. We want to see how your skills match what we're looking for!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you're passionate about this role and how you can contribute to our team. Keep it concise but engaging ā we love a good story!
Showcase Your Projects: If you've got any personal or professional projects that demonstrate your full stack development skills, make sure to include them. Weāre keen to see your problem-solving mindset in action, so donāt hold back!
Apply Through Our Website: We encourage you to apply through our website for the best chance of getting noticed. Itās super easy, and youāll be one step closer to joining our innovative team at StudySmarter!
How to prepare for a job interview at Stefanini North America and APAC
āØKnow Your Tech Stack
Make sure you brush up on your Java EE, Spring Framework, and Angular skills. Be ready to discuss your experience with these technologies and how you've used them in past projects. Itās a great way to show youāre not just familiar but truly proficient.
āØShowcase Problem-Solving Skills
Prepare to discuss specific challenges you've faced in software development and how you tackled them. Stefanini values an innovative mindset, so think of examples where youāve had to think outside the box to find solutions.
āØEngage with Stakeholders
Since the role involves direct stakeholder engagement, be prepared to talk about how youāve communicated with non-technical team members in the past. Highlight your ability to translate complex technical concepts into understandable terms.
āØDemonstrate Your Passion for Learning
Stefanini is looking for self-motivated individuals who are eager to learn. Share examples of new technologies or methodologies youāve recently explored and how they could benefit the team. This shows you're proactive and committed to personal growth.